发明名称 PHASE TRANSITION TYPE INFORMATION RECORDING MEDIUM
摘要 <P>PROBLEM TO BE SOLVED: To provide a phase transition type information recording medium which does not generate noises such as a jitter against a low-power light of short wavelength such as a blue laser, has an excellent O/W (overwrite) property and a good archival property, and permits high-density recording. <P>SOLUTION: The phase transition type information recording medium has at least a first recording configuration layer, a resin intermediate layer, and a second recording configuration layer set up in order on a substrate. The first recording configuration layer consists of a reflective heat sink layer, a first protective layer, a first recording layer, and a second protective layer in order from the substrate side. The second recording configuration layer consists of a buffer layer, an ITO (indium tin oxide), Ag, or Ag alloy layer as a third protective layer, a fourth protective layer, a second recording layer, a fifth protective layer in order from the resin intermediate layer side. The first recording layer and the second recording layer contain at least SbTe, the buffer layer is an oxide, and transmissivity of light of the third protective layer and the buffer layer is 80% or more. <P>COPYRIGHT: (C)2004,JPO
